EXCLUSIVE: Former Victory star Ljubo Milicevic is still in Melbourne, close to full fitness - and hoping to reignite his football career.
“He is almost at full fitness now. He has continued to train and is open to offers,” says a source.
Milicevic, 26, parted ways with Victory last month. A knee injury in round one of last season's A-League curtailed much of his campaign and he never really recovered from that blow.
The former Perth Glory and FC Thun star had originally targeted tonight's opening AFC champions league encounter with Chunnam Dragons as his comeback before splitting with the club one year into his two year deal at Telstra Dome.
However, a recent family loss has been another blow to the player who has remained in Melbourne with his family since.
